摘要

阐述660MW燃煤机组选择性催化还原脱硝系统的特点,针对在超低排放过程中出现的因设备缺陷、逻辑不当、NOx分布不均、氨逃逸大的异常,造成脱硝系统自动长期无法投入、脱硝耗材增加的问题,探讨运行状况和诊断策略,采取有效的预防措施.

Abstract

This paper expounds the characteristics of the selective catalytic reduction denitrification system for 660MW coal-fired units.In response to the problems of equipment defects,improper logic,uneven distribution of NOx,and large ammonia escape that occur during the ultra-low emission process,resulting in the automatic long-term inability to put the denitrification system into operation and an increase in denitrification consumables,it explores the operating conditions and diagnostic strategies,and takes effective preventive measures.
